LOL.<br />Your son has done well and I hope he enjoys uni.<br />Carol CAnonymoushttps://www.blogger.com/profile/11388293092807768779noreply@blogger.comtag:blogger.com,1999:blog-6930416465746558041.post-13084313287463221832011-08-25T08:57:56.928+01:002011-08-25T08:57:56.928+01:00If ever you touch the bobbin tension you should on...If ever you touch the bobbin tension you should only do it a quarter turn of the screw at a time and mark whether you have moved it left or right. eg., Write down "2 left" or" 4 right" so you can gauge which way is making it better or not and then return to the original setting before going the opposite direction. Hope you can understand this?? There may be thread stuck under the spring of the bobbin so look at it with a magnifier and you may be able to use fine tweezers to remove it.
